Project Overview
Ammoprices is a Phoenix 1.8 web application that scrapes ammunition prices from multiple online retailers, tracks price history, and displays analytics. Built with Elixir ~> 1.15, LiveView, Ecto/PostgreSQL, Tailwind CSS v4, and daisyUI.
Common Commands
mix setup # Install deps, create DB, run migrations, build assets
mix phx.server # Start dev server (localhost:4000)
iex -S mix phx.server # Start dev server with IEx shell
mix test # Run all tests (auto-creates/migrates test DB)
mix test test/path_test.exs # Run a single test file
mix test test/path_test.exs:42 # Run a specific test by line number
mix test --failed # Re-run previously failed tests
mix precommit # Compile (warnings-as-errors) + unlock unused deps + format + credo --strict + test
mix format # Format code
mix ecto.gen.migration name # Generate a new migration
mix ecto.migrate # Run pending migrations
mix ecto.reset # Drop and recreate database
mix precommit is the required pre-commit check — always run it before finishing changes.
Architecture
Domain Contexts
Catalog (lib/ammoprices/catalog/) — Retailers, calibers, and products.
Retailer: name, slug (unique), base_url, enabled flag, last_scraped_atCaliber: name, slug (unique), category (handgun/rifle/rimfire/shotgun), aliases arrayProduct: belongs_to retailer & caliber. Fields: title, url (unique per retailer), brand, grain_weight, round_count, casing (brass/steel/aluminum/alloy/composite), subsonic, in_stock. Upserted on (retailer_id, url) conflict
Prices (lib/ammoprices/prices/) — Immutable price snapshots and analytics.
PriceSnapshot: price_cents, price_per_round_cents, in_stock, recorded_at. Append-only (no updated_at)- Queries: latest prices per product (with filters), daily averages, price stats (min/max/avg), cheapest per caliber
Scraping Pipeline (lib/ammoprices/scraping/)
ScrapeJob (Oban, every 4h) → Runner → Scraper (per retailer) → HttpClient → Floki/JSON parse
↓
Upsert products → Create snapshots → PubSub broadcast
- Scraper behaviour: Required callbacks
retailer_slug/0,category_url/1,parse_products/1. Optionalfetch/2for custom HTTP (e.g., GraphQL) - Runner: Checks
function_exported?forfetch/2— uses it if available, otherwise standard HTTP GET + parse flow - HttpClient: Req-based with realistic Chrome headers, retries. Has
get/1andpost_json/3 - TextDetector: Regex detection of subsonic and casing type from product titles
- CaliberMatcher: Matches products to calibers via name/alias lookup
- ScrapeJob: Oban worker, queue
:scraping(concurrency 2), 5-15 min random delay between requests in prod, 0 in test
Retailers (7 scrapers in lib/ammoprices/scraping/retailers/):
| Retailer | Type |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Lucky Gunner | HTML (Floki) | Slug-to-URL mapping per caliber |
| SG Ammo | HTML (Floki) | Standard HTML parsing |
| Target Sports USA | HTML (Floki) | Standard HTML parsing |
| True Shot Ammo | JSON API (Shopify) | /collections/{handle}/products.json, parse_products accepts decoded map |
| Palmetto State Armory | HTML (Magento) | data-price-amount attrs, brand = first word of title |
| Bulk Ammo | HTML (Magento) | a.product-name, brand via regex from title |
| Natchez | GraphQL | Uses fetch/2 callback, HttpClient.post_json/3, requires Store: default header |
Web Layer
Routes:
GET /→HomeLive— Calibers grouped by category with cheapest CPR per caliberGET /calibers/:slug→CaliberLive.Show— Price table, Chart.js chart, filter bar, stats
CaliberLive.Show filters: in_stock (toggle), casing (mutually exclusive), grain_weight (mutually exclusive), subsonic (toggle, only shown when subsonic products exist). Chart range: 7d/30d/90d/1y/all.
Real-time: PubSub on "prices:updated" topic. CaliberLive.Show subscribes on connect; broadcasts trigger reload of filter options, product stream, chart, and stats.
